Mark J. Butler II, a native Philadelphian and graduate of Northeast Catholic High School, is a Veteran of the United States Navy where he completed two tours, "Operation Enduring Freedom" and "Operation Iraqi Freedom" before being honorably discharged in 2004.
It was only after serving his country that Mark decided to embark on a career in construction. Since gaining extensive project management knowledge as well as developing advanced skills in various construction trades, he decided it was time to form his own construction company, and in 2011 MJB Builders was born.
?Mark Butler now holds several certifications, including OSHA 30 Hour, CMI (Certified Mold Inspector) & CMRC (Certified Mold Remediation Contractor).
